Submersible sludge pumps play a crucial role in various industries. They effectively manage thick, viscous sludge, ensuring smooth operations in wastewater treatment and industrial processes. The expected demand for these pumps in 2026 will likely rise due to increasing environmental regulations and the need for efficient waste management.

Many users often overlook the challenges in selecting the right pump. It's essential to consider the specific application, fluid characteristics, and operating conditions. A pump that performs excellently in one setting may underperform in another. Users should pay attention to the pump's material compatibility and the viscosity of the sludge being managed. Regular maintenance also proves vital for longer pump life. Neglecting this can lead to significant downtime and increased costs.

Comparative Analysis of Efficiency in Sludge Pump Models

When assessing sludge pump efficiency, various models emerge with distinct features. Each pump type caters to specific applications. Understanding their strengths and weaknesses can guide users in making informed choices. Some submersible pumps boast high flow rates but struggle with viscous materials. Others excel in handling thick sludge but may sacrifice speed.

Energy consumption is another key factor to consider. Efficient pumps ideally balance performance and power use. Models that minimize energy without compromising output are increasingly sought after. However, not every efficient model is suitable for all environments. Users must assess their sludge characteristics before selecting a pump.

Regular maintenance also influences efficiency. Ignoring upkeep leads to reduced performance over time, regardless of model. Users should reflect on operational practices. A pump's design might allow for easy maintenance, but overlooking this aspect can diminish its advantages. Balancing pump selection with maintenance strategies creates a more reliable solution in the long run.
